Woodes Rogers arrived in the Bahamas on July 22, 1718. He was appointed as the first royal governor of the Bahamas and played a significant role in restoring order to the islands, which had been plagued by piracy. His arrival marked a turning point in the fight against piracy in the region.

The problems of piracy in the Bahamas were largely overcome through a combination of increased naval presence and legal reforms. The British government, recognizing the threat to trade and stability, dispatched naval forces to patrol the waters and suppress pirate activities. Additionally, the establishment of a formal government and laws helped to regulate commerce and restore order, while offering former pirates amnesty in exchange for their cooperation. These measures effectively diminished piracy and allowed for the development of legitimate trade in the region.
